hoof fungus
Meaning
Fomes fomentarius, a fungal plant pathogen found in Europe, Asia, Africa and North America, producing large polypore fruit bodies shaped like a horse's hoof.
Translations
Notes
Sign in to write sticky notes
Start learning English with learnfeliz.
Practice speaking and memorizing "hoof fungus" and many other words and sentences in English.